Top 5 Superhero Games on Android in Netherlands, Q4 2021

In the fourth quarter of 2021, the top 5 superhero games on the Android platform in the Netherlands showcased varying performance trends in terms of revenue, downloads, and active users. Here's a detailed look at how each game fared, based on data from Sensor Tower.

DRAGON BALL Z DOKKAN BATTLE from Bandai Namco Entertainment Inc. experienced fluctuations in its weekly revenue, starting at around $11.7K at the end of September and peaking at approximately $17.9K in the week of December 20. Weekly downloads saw a significant increase towards the end of the quarter, rising to 427 in the last week of December from a steady 100-150 range earlier in the quarter. Active users showed a steady climb, peaking at 5.4K in the final week.

MARVEL Strike Force: Squad RPG by Scopely maintained relatively stable weekly revenue throughout the quarter, with notable peaks of around $15K in the week of December 20. Downloads fluctuated, reaching a high of 654 in mid-October and stabilizing around 450-500 towards the end of the quarter. Active user numbers remained steady, with a slight increase to 2.9K by the end of December.

Marvel Contest of Champions from Kabam Games, Inc. saw a substantial rise in weekly revenue, peaking at $17K in the week of December 20, up from $6.7K at the start of the quarter. Downloads also increased significantly, reaching 683 by the last week of December. Active users grew consistently, ending the quarter at 2.6K.

Legendary: Game of Heroes by PerBlue Entertainment had a more modest performance. Weekly revenue fluctuated, peaking at $3.4K in late October before stabilizing around $2K towards the end of the quarter. Active user numbers were relatively low and showed a downward trend, ending the quarter with 99 users.

MHA:The Strongest Hero from A PLUS JAPAN exhibited varied weekly revenue, peaking at $3.6K in the week of December 20. Downloads remained consistent throughout the quarter, with a slight peak at 225 in mid-December. Active users remained stable, ending the quarter with approximately 1.4K users.
